Transaction 521e95894af29dcd1d91b1bb06f2bbbc61693ee9f9a14165dcb6418dece3dad9
1 Input
1 Output
-
521e95894af29dcd1d91b1bb06f2bbbc61693ee9f9a14165dcb6418dece3dad9:0
- value
- 1599156
- script pubkey
- OP_0 OP_PUSHBYTES_20 867d6c1e19995766c579478eecdf2f2ffdb14f6e
- address
- bc1qse7kc8sen9tkd3teg78wehe09l7mznmw6erd90